Two men charged in connection to body found behind Tabb library

YORK COUNTY, Va.- The York-Poquoson Sheriff's Office reported a body found behind Tabb Library Monday afternoon.

Police officials say they responded to a suspicious incident in the 100 block of Long Green Boulevard that led to a death investigation.

Police say they were able to determine that the case originated in Norfolk and the victim, identified as 45-year-old Norfolk woman Marcia Dumas, was not a York County resident.

Two individuals have been charged by York-Poquoson Detectives. 42-year-old Robert Carroll Jr., of Norfolk, has been charged with Strangulation of Another, Prohibition Against Concealment of a Dead Body, and Unlawful Disposal of a Dead Body. 43-year-old Kevin Dunn, of Norfolk, has been charged with Unlawful Disposal of a Dead Body.

The Norfolk Police Department will now take over the investigation and handle any statements, questions or concerns relating to the death investigation.

“I am very proud of the work done by all of my deputies and staff. The Investigations Division did an outstanding job of determining. I would also like to thank our citizens for providing us with a lot of information that in turn helped us solve the case," Sherriff Diggs said.

Carroll Jr. and Dunn are being held at Norfolk City Jail without bond.
